Mazda 3 Service Manual: Steering Switch Removal/Installation

Mazda 3 Service Manual / Steering / Steering Switch Removal/Installation

WARNING:

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able and wait for 1 min or more

..

2. Remove the driver-side air bag module..

3. Remove the steering wheel..

4. Remove the screw.


5. Remove the wiring harness from the cover hook.


6. Remove the cover tabs and pins from the steering wheel.



7. Remove the cover.

8. Disconnect the connector.


9. Remove the screw.

10. Remove the steering switch pins from the steering wheel.


11. Remove the steering switch.

12. Install in the reverse order of removal.
